Visa Steel trades jubilantly on the BSE

23 Sep 2015 Evaluate

Visa Steel is currently trading at Rs. 17.15, up by 2.71 points or 18.77% from its previous closing of Rs. 14.44 on the BSE.

The scrip opened at Rs. 15.00 and has touched a high and low of Rs. 17.32 and Rs. 14.52 respectively. So far 141225 shares were traded on the counter.

The BSE group 'B' stock of face value Rs. 10 has touched a 52 week high of Rs. 25.00 on 09-Apr-2015 and a 52 week low of Rs. 13.00 on 11-Sep-2015.

Last one week high and low of the scrip stood at Rs. 17.32 and Rs. 14.03 respectively. The current market cap of the company is Rs. 189.09 crore.

The promoters holding in the company stood at 67.20% while Institutions and Non-Institutions held 18.33% and 14.47% respectively.

Visa Steel is planning to convert a large portion of its debt into equity using the Reserve Bank of India’s (RBI) strategic debt restructuring (SDR) scheme. The Lenders of the Company in its Joint Lenders Forum (JLF) meeting held on September 22, 2015 have decided to invoke Strategic Debt Restructuring (SDR) pursuant to RBI Circular dated June 08, 2015. The Company is in discussion with Lenders for preparing a conversion package to enable inviting a strategic investor in its Special Steel Business.

Visa Steel is a flagship company of the Visa Group, which has business interests in Steel, Power, Cement, International Trading and Urban Infrastructure etc. The Company is a leading player in the Special Steel, Ferro Chrome and Metallurgical Coke Business in India. The Company has a strong backing of experienced Promoters, reputed Board of Directors and qualified team of professionals. VISA Steel’s shares are traded on the BSE and NSE.
